Abstract
本发明属于防菌垫领域,具体涉及一种新型透气除臭抗菌垫,自下而上包括基布层、记忆海绵层、气孔层、记忆海绵层、负离子层、以及甲壳素纤维层;所述的负离子层由经线、纬线制造而成,所述经线、纬线相交处的凹陷面内设有负离子微胶囊;所述的负离子微胶囊包括下述重量份组份:芯材:抗菌负离子粉50‑45份,乳化剂25‑50份;壁材:脲醛树脂35‑45份。本发明提供的新型透气除臭抗菌垫具有良好的透气性、散热性、持久的抗菌抑菌功能以及除臭功能,同时,该垫的制作材料也应对人体无害、对皮肤无刺激性。
Description
技术领域
本发明属于除菌垫领域,具体涉及一种新型透气除臭抗菌垫。
背景技术
近年来,随着人们对美好生活的需要与技术的不断提升,出现了抗静电垫、增高垫、防水垫等功能垫。但目前市场上的常规垫大多数存在透气性不佳等缺点。如果垫子的透气性能与散热性能较差,容易导致滋生大量的细菌。因此,为了使使用者提供更加舒适的体验,需要使垫子具有良好的透气性、散热性、持久的抗菌抑菌功能以及除臭功能,同时,垫子的制作材料也应对人体无害、对皮肤无刺激性。
发明内容
本发明的目的在于提供一种新型透气除臭抗菌垫。
本发明为实现上述目的,采用以下技术方案:
一种新型透气除臭抗菌垫,自下而上包括基布层、记忆海绵层、气孔层、记忆海绵层、负离子层、以及甲壳素纤维层;
所述的负离子层由经线、纬线制造而成,所述经线、纬线相交处的凹陷面内设有负离子微胶囊;所述的负离子微胶囊包括下述重量份组份:
芯材:抗菌负离子粉45-50份,乳化剂25-50份;
壁材:脲醛树脂35-45份。
所述的抗菌负离子粉包括下述重量份组份:纳米级二氧化钛3份、硅藻土16份、电气石粉10份、竹炭粉5份。
所述的负离子微胶囊采用下述方式制备:
1)所述脲醛树脂由尿素和甲醛按摩尔比1:2合成;将尿素和甲醛溶液混合,按搅拌溶解后,调节pH至8,在65度下反应1h得到透明粘稠的脲醛树脂预聚体;
2)囊芯乳化液的合成:将抗菌负离子粉加入到乳化剂水溶液中,加热至45℃度搅拌,并用高剪切分散乳化机在5000-15000r/min的转速下进行乳化,得到囊芯乳化液;各组分质量比例为5份抗菌负离子粉、30份水、0.5份乳化剂;
3)将制成的脲醛树脂预聚体与囊芯乳化液混合:使脲醛树脂预聚体溶解于乳化液的分散介质水中保持温度50-60℃,搅拌,滴加冰醋酸溶液溶液调节PH=4时,在氮气保护下,开始加热升温;当pH达到2.8-3.0时温度同时上升到70度,在氮气保护下,保温0.5-1h;再滴加冰醋酸溶液至pH为2.0,保温1h,用三乙醇胺调节pH到6-8;自然降温,静置分层,去掉上层清液,将沉淀物抽滤干燥得到可得负离子微胶囊。
所述乳化剂为十二烷基苯磺酸钠、聚乙烯醇、或者聚丙烯酸钠中的一种。
所述的基布层为纳米磷酸锆载银抗菌纤维层。
所述的纳米磷酸锆载银抗菌纤维层采用下述方式制备:
1)纳米磷酸锆载银抗菌剂的制备:a)将磷酸锆粉体与多巯基化合物分散于有机溶剂中,在室温下密闭超声分散0.5~2小时;b)加入硝酸银,500r/min搅拌12-15小时;其中,所述的磷酸锆粉体、多巯基化合物和硝酸银的质量比为100∶1~6∶8~20;c)利用喷雾干燥的方式去除有机溶剂;d)将获得的粉体置于800℃-1000℃温度煅烧3-4个小时,得到纳米磷酸锆载银抗菌剂;
2)纳米磷酸锆载银抗菌纤维层的制备:a):按照上述步骤获得纳米磷酸锆载银抗菌剂后,将纳米磷酸锆载银抗菌剂与聚酰胺树脂经双螺杆造粒机造粒,获得具有抗菌功能的聚酰胺母粒,所述的抗菌功能聚酰胺母粒中载银磷酸锆的质量百分比为10%~20%;b)将抗菌聚酰胺母粒和聚酰胺树脂按质量比50∶100经熔融纺丝制备出纳米磷酸锆载银抗菌纤维层。
所述的多巯基化合物为二巯基乙酸乙二醇酯、1,3-二巯基丙烷、季戊四醇四巯基乙酸酯和季戊四醇四-3-巯基丙酸酯等的一种或几种;所述的有机溶剂为乙醇、丙酮的一种。
所述的气孔层上开设多个直径为1.5mm的小气孔,用于空气流通。
与现有技术相比,本发明的有益效果是:
(1)抗菌、抑菌性:基布层所含纳米磷酸锆载银抗菌剂具有抗菌抑菌的作用,可对多类细菌进行高效广谱的杀灭和去除;负离子层中的微胶囊慢慢释放负离子,起到有效杀菌的作用;与使用者直接接触的甲壳素纤维层,具有抗感染、抗菌功能,有效抑制细菌的滋生。
(2)透气性:记忆海绵层-气孔层-记忆海绵层的“三明治结构”有效提高了垫的透气性能。记忆海绵的通透泡孔结构,保证了人体皮肤需要的透气性,同时记忆海绵层(2)为气孔层提供了排气通道,保证了垫子的空气流通。
(3)散热性:由于甲壳素具有很强的吸湿性,汗液被甲壳素纤维层吸收并通过记忆海绵层、透气层向外层扩散、蒸发。
(4)除臭性:微胶囊释放出的负离子,起到杀菌、除臭、净化空气的作用;位于负离子层上方的甲壳素纤维层也具有抗感染、抗菌、除臭的功能。
(5)亲肤性:与皮肤直接接触的甲壳素纤维对人体无毒无刺激,可被人体内的溶菌酶分解而吸收,与人体组织有良好的生物相容性。同时,本申请的新型垫采用的材料对皮肤无刺激性。
(6)减震性:本申请的新型垫采用的记忆海绵层不仅具有良好的透气性还具有吸收冲击力、减少震动、低反弹力释放的作用,因而有效提高了垫的减震性能。
(7)耐磨性:特别是纳米磷酸锆载银抗菌剂能持久地与高分子材料相结合,化学稳定性好,在较宽的PH范围内化学稳定,能经受表面活性剂多次洗涤,其抗菌力不下降。聚酰胺具有无毒、质轻、耐磨等特性,提高了垫的耐磨性。

具体实施方式
为了使本技术领域的技术人员更好地理解本发明的技术方案,下面结合附图和最佳实施例对本发明作进一步的详细说明。
图1示出一种新型透气除臭抗菌垫,自下而上包括基布层1、记忆海绵层2、气孔层3、记忆海绵层4、负离子层5、以及甲壳素纤维层6;所述的负离子层由经线、纬线制造而成,所述经线、纬线相交处的凹陷面内设有负离子微胶囊;所述的负离子微胶囊包括下述重量份组份:
实施例1:芯材:抗菌负离子粉48份,乳化剂35份;壁材:脲醛树脂40份。所述的抗菌负离子粉包括下述重量份组份:纳米级二氧化钛3份、硅藻土16份、电气石粉10份、竹炭粉5份。
所述的负离子微胶囊采用下述方式制备:
1)所述脲醛树脂由尿素和甲醛按摩尔比1:2合成;将尿素和甲醛溶液混合,按搅拌溶解后,调节pH至8,在65度下反应1h得到透明粘稠的脲醛树脂预聚体;
2)囊芯乳化液的合成:将抗菌负离子粉加入到乳化剂十二烷基苯磺酸钠的水溶液中,加热至45℃度搅拌,并用高剪切分散乳化机在5000-15000r/min的转速下进行乳化,得到囊芯乳化液;各组分质量比例为5份抗菌负离子粉、30份水、0.5份乳化剂;
3)将制成的脲醛树脂预聚体与囊芯乳化液混合:使脲醛树脂预聚体溶解于乳化液的分散介质水中保持温度50-60℃,搅拌,滴加冰醋酸溶液溶液调节PH=4时,在氮气保护下,开始加热升温;当pH达到2.8-3.0时温度同时上升到70度,在氮气保护下,保温0.5-1h;再滴加冰醋酸溶液至pH为2.0,保温1h,用三乙醇胺调节pH到6-8;自然降温,静置分层,去掉上层清液,将沉淀物抽滤干燥得到可得负离子微胶囊。
所述的基布层为纳米磷酸锆载银抗菌纤维层。
所述的纳米磷酸锆载银抗菌纤维层采用下述方式制备:
1)纳米磷酸锆载银抗菌剂的制备:a)将磷酸锆粉体与多巯基化合物二巯基乙酸乙二醇酯分散于有机溶剂乙醇中,在室温下密闭超声分散0.5~2小时;b)加入硝酸银,500r/min搅拌12-15小时;其中,所述的磷酸锆粉体、多巯基化合物和硝酸银的质量比为100∶3∶15;c)利用喷雾干燥的方式去除有机溶剂;d)将获得的粉体置于800℃-1000℃温度煅烧3-4个小时,得到纳米磷酸锆载银抗菌剂;
2)纳米磷酸锆载银抗菌纤维层的制备:a):按照上述步骤获得纳米磷酸锆载银抗菌剂后,将纳米磷酸锆载银抗菌剂与聚酰胺树脂经双螺杆造粒机造粒,获得具有抗菌功能的聚酰胺母粒,所述的抗菌功能聚酰胺母粒中载银磷酸锆的质量百分比为15%;b)将抗菌聚酰胺母粒和聚酰胺树脂按质量比50∶100经熔融纺丝制备出纳米磷酸锆载银抗菌纤维层。
所述的气孔层上开设多个直径为1.5mm的小气孔,用于空气流通。
